The word “thou” itself carries a significant weight, as it hails from Old English. In modern English, it is primarily used as an archaic or poetic form of “you.” However, its prominence in older works of literature and religious texts, such as Shakespearean plays and the King James Bible, grants it a sense of grandeur and reverence. Q: What does the word “thou” mean?
A: “Thou” is an archaic English pronoun that was used to refer to the second person singular, similar to “you.”

Q: Can “thou” be used in modern English conversations?
A: While “thou” is considered outdated and is generally not used in everyday speech, it can still be found in literary works or to add a historical or poetic touch to a piece of writing.

FAQ 4:
Q: Is there any difference between “thou” and “you” in terms of meaning?
A: In the past, “thou” was used to address a single person informally, while “you” was used for formal or plural situations. However, in modern English, “you” has become the standard pronoun for all situations.
